RANGERS have joined the race to sign Aston Villa starlet Cameron Archer, according to a report.
The 20-year-old spent last season on loan with Preston in the English Championship, where he bagged on seven occasions.
This has led to growing interest in the young striker for various clubs across England.
And talkSPORT report that the Ibrox club have joined them by showing interest in the U21 striker.
Middlesbrough and Watford are reported to be in the hunt for Archer's signature.
It remains to be seen whether Steven Gerrard's connections to Rangers would have any bearing in a potential deal.
